Anthropic CEO Criticizes OpenAI Pentagon Partnership

Anthropic CEO Dario Amodei circulated an internal memo accusing OpenAI of misrepresenting its Pentagon partnership. The memo points to an escalating rivalry as governments pursue advanced AI models for defense and intelligence. It underscores the strategic value of AI in military applications and the pressure on firms to win government contracts.

OpenAI, Stanford, and Tartu Launch AI Learning Impact Framework

OpenAI, in partnership with Stanford University and the University of Tartu, introduced a research framework to assess AI’s effect on student learning over time. The Learning Outcomes Measurement Suite tracks metrics such as motivation, persistence, and recall. In a pilot with more than 300 students, participants using ChatGPT’s study mode achieved a 15 percent increase in micro‑economics scores, while other subjects showed no significant change. The framework is now being deployed in Estonia to monitor 20,000 high‑school students throughout a semester.

Anthropic Adds Memory‑Import Feature to Claude

Anthropic released a memory‑import tool for Claude that lets users transfer saved prompts, context, and preferences from other AI services with a single copy‑paste. Users copy a provided prompt, paste the output into Claude, and their instructions, personal details, project context, and behavioral preferences are migrated within 24 hours. The feature is offered free to all users, and Claude Code now includes an auto‑memory upgrade that retains context across sessions. This simplifies migration to Claude and improves continuity for users switching between AI platforms.

Researchers Present Code Understanding Agents Framework

Researchers introduced Code Understanding Agents, a semi‑formal reasoning framework that structures large language model prompts around explicit premises, execution traces, and formal conclusions. By organizing prompts in this way, agents can analyze code semantics without executing the program. The approach improves performance on tasks such as patch verification, fault localization, and code question‑answering benchmarks. These gains enhance the reliability of AI‑driven code analysis tools, moving toward more trustworthy automated software engineering.
